Panasonic Lumix S l-mount PRO 70-200mm f/2.8 O.I.S Telephoto Zoom Lens Summary
The newly announced full-frame Lumix S PRO 70-200mm f/2.8 O.I.S lens from Panasonic compliments the . Both are the latest additions to the L-mount range of lenses, forming two of the three trinity workhorse zooms, which make up many photographers primary focal lengths.
The Lumix 70-200 has been developed from the Leica and Sigma alliance, and Panasonic have developed this latest addition to wear their PRO badge of quality. This ensures the highest possible optical results with the inclusion of several image enhancing elements. This optical design includes no less than 22 elements in 17 groups, yet weighs only 1570g, which is relatively light for such a complex design. Quality is optimised with the inclusion of 1 aspherical element to reduce aberrations, 3 ED lenses enhancing contrast and sharpness as well as 2 UED lenses, which keep down weight and improve image quality even further.
70-200 is a classic focal zoom range which is versatile enough for many photographic subjects. These include portraits, weddings, landscapes and even closer wildlife shooting. With the fast and bright constant aperture this lens is ideal in any low light situations. Optical stabilisation further enhances hand-held shooting abilities, which will be most welcome to the majority of users. The design is made up with 11 diaphragm blades which is very impressive and ensures beautiful smooth bokeh for out of focus areas.
The lens has a focal range from 94cm to infinity, allowing photographers to get extremely close to their subjects. This creates new possibilities of macro-style shooting as well as capturing pin sharp subjects along a than focal plane, with plenty of smooth background. The lens has been constructed to be dust and splash proof, ideal for outdoor shooting and has a large 82mm filter thread for the addition of rings or filters.
PANASONIC LUMIX L-MOUNT S PRO 70-200MM F/2.8 O.I.S TELEPHOTO ZOOM LENS SPECIFICATIONS
| Lens construction | 22 elements in 17 groups (1 aspherical lens, 3 ED lenses, 2 UED lenses) |
| Mount | L-Mount |
| Optical image stabiliser | Yes |
| Focal Length | 70-200mm |
| Aperture Type | 11 diaphragm blades / Circular aperture diaphragm |
| Maximum Aperture | F/2.8 |
| Minimum Aperture | F/22 |
| Closest focusing distance | 0.95m |
| Maximum magnification | Approx. 0.21x |
| Diagonal angle of view | 34°(Wide) – 12°(Tele) |
| Dust and Splash resistant | Yes* |
| Recommended Operating Temperature | -10oC to 40oC (14oF to 104oF) |
| Filter Size | φ82mm |
| Max. Diameter | φ94.4mm |
| Overall Length | Approx.208.6mm |
| Weight | Approx. 1570g |
| Standard accessories | Lens cap, Lens rear cap, External tripod mount, Lens hood, Lens storage bag |
